7 Real Estate Direct Marketing Tips to Boost Response Rates

Real estate direct mail marketing is an affordable and effective way to get noticed, leading to more leads and opportunities for sales.  Here are some real estate direct marketing tips to boost response rates for a better ROI.

1.  Experiment with Real Estate Letters Versus Postcards

Should you use letters or postcards to conduct a real estate direct mail campaign? Answering this question is one of your first steps before launching your campaign.

Unfortunately, one way or the other isn’t ideal for all campaigns, so you may have to experiment. A postcard may work best for specific properties for sale but won’t be as effective if you have more information to share.

2.  Use a Simple Message with Clear Benefits

If you only use one tip from this, make sure it’s this one. This key takeaway is vital for direct mail marketing campaigns. Your marketing message has to be simple enough so readers can see the benefits right away. They probably will not spend more than five seconds reading your message.

Answer these two questions quickly: What are you offering them and what are the benefits?

Real Estate Direct Marketing

3.  Tell Your Readers What to do Next

When it comes to real estate direct marketing your message should steer them to the next step. Perhaps you want them to contact you to find out more information about a listing or list their home with you if they are looking to sell. Make it clear.

4.  Don’t Ever Make Guarantees

Never guarantee that a property will be available or that they will get a specific amount of money for their property. If your campaign involves a mortgage special make sure you follow the guidelines of the Consumer Financial Protection Bureau and the FTC.

Although you can explain the benefits of a special mortgage, never tell people they will be automatically approved.

5.  Guide Your Readers to a Specific Section on Your Website

When using direct mail you don’t always have the space you need on your mail piece to communicate all of the relevant information regarding your products and services, especially if you’re using a postcard. This is why you need to send readers to a specific page on your website. Make sure the webpage is both informative and relevant to your message.

6.  Establish a Direct Mail Control and Try to Beat it

Control in direct mail marketing is the first piece of mail you create that makes a profit. It is a prototype of sorts. Measure your response rate and ROI for this control; and then try to beat it.

You can do this by changing one element at a time.

Second Technique – Add Personalized Touches to the Direct Mail Marketing Campaign 

 

Some direct marketing mail gets thrown out by customers because it looks like junk mail. A great direct mail marketing company, however, can make a mail marketing campaign looks just like any other personal mail so it’s less likely to be discarded. These personalized touches can include things like having a hand addressed envelope for a marketing letter be in a handwritten font in blue or black ink. Or by using authentic peel and stick postage stamps, as compared to postage imprints that other mail marketing services may use, which most people will visually associate with junk mail. When people see a hand written envelope addressed to them personally, with real postage, they will be more likely to open the sales letter and read the contents inside.

Direct Mail Marketing Ideas for Non-Profit Fundraising Events

Nonprofits rely on the generosity of their community and local government, as well as the broader government to provide funding in the form of grants and donations. Sometimes it can take a lot of legwork to drum up the interest you need to see a positive cash flow. Here are some non profit direct mail ideas that will help you reach potential donors.

Develop a solid mailing list

Word of mouth is one of the best ways to develop a successful mailing list. You want people that you know will give to a charitable organization, and sometimes that is best achieved by speaking to people you already know. Networking is a great way to get in touch with like-minded people and increase your chances of making a mailing list that really converts.

Do something different

Consider using direct mail to send something eye-catching to potential supporters of your cause. A regular old flyer may not be the best way to go, but a postcard mailer, magnets and even bookmarks are far more useful than for just a quick read. If you send your contact list something that serves a purpose, it will remain in their home as a useful reminder, long after the recycling hits the curb.

Be informative

Provide lots of information in your mailer, without being overwhelming. This can be achieved by cleverly arranging the flow ofDirect Mail Marketing information through a layout design, as well as choosing an appealing font. Provide simple contact information, and what your organization is all about (your message), as well as what people can do to help.

Be fun

Newsletters are a great alternative to typical direct mail. It helps provide direct and indirect information to your contact list, without being preachy or demanding. A newsletter can include relevant anecdotes, quotes, jokes and important dates, in an enjoyable format. The newsletters also give you the opportunity to send regularly and ongoing literature to your contact list, which is an important part of forging a relationship with potential donors.

Be eye-catching

If you have an important fundraising event coming up, sending out direct mail specifically to promote it is important. If you use newsletters, you can mention the event repeatedly, leading up to the date, but a dedicated advertisement is also necessary. Make it pop, make it informative and be sure it is easily identifiable from any other mail you may send out.
